Leaf Mulch
Leaf Mulch is a natural blend of recycled leaves, bark, needles and twigs. As it breaks down, it enriches soil with nitrogen, phosphorus and potassium while also helping to suppress weeds, lock in moisture, and regulate soil temperature. Once decomposed, it can be easily mixed into the soil to continue feeding your garden.

Tea Tree Mulch
Tea Tree Mulch is a fine-textured, dark mulch made from chopped tea tree stems and leaves. Naturally aromatic and termite-resistant, it’s great for moisture retention, weed control, and maintaining consistent soil temperature. As it breaks down, it enriches the soil with nitrogen, phosphorus and potassium.

What Type of Mulch is Best for My Garden?
That depends on your garden’s needs. Organic mulch, like composted bark or sugarcane, is excellent for vegetable gardens and flower beds because it breaks down and feeds the soil. Wood chip mulch is long-lasting and perfect for general landscaping, while decorative mulch is often used in front yards or feature areas to enhance visual appeal.
How Thick Should I Apply Mulch?
A good rule of thumb is 7–10cm thick. This depth is enough to block sunlight from reaching weed seeds, retain moisture, and insulate the soil. Avoid piling mulch against plant stems or trunks—it can lead to rot or disease. Spread it evenly and refresh it once or twice yearly to maintain its benefits.
Can Mulch Improve Soil Quality?
Yes, especially organic mulch. As it breaks down, it adds nutrients to the soil, improves texture, and encourages healthy microbes. This natural process helps maintain good soil structure and supports root development. Over time, using mulch consistently can lead to richer, healthier soil without needing as many chemical fertilisers.
